Established in 1970, James Cook University (JCU) is a public university with campuses in Townsville and Cairns, Queensland. With a student population of over 23,000, including more than 6,000 international students, JCU is known for its strong research and teaching programs in marine biology, tropical health, environmental science, and engineering. The tropical location of its campuses provides students with access to unique ecosystems, research opportunities, and a vibrant campus life.

Finding the right place to live in Brisbane can make a big difference in your student experience. The city has many neighborhoods that suit different lifestyles, whether you want to be close to universities, near nightlife, or somewhere quieter to focus on your studies. Below are a few of the best areas of Brisbane where you can stay in your student accommodations hassle-free:
1. St Lucia – Home to the University of Queensland (UQ), this suburb is very popular with students. It’s full of cafés, student accommodation, and parks along the river. The commute to the UQ campus is mostly 5–10 minutes on foot or by bike. Rent usually falls between $400–$600/week.
2. South Bank – Vibrant and cultural, South Bank offers riverside living, restaurants, cinemas, and easy access to museums and galleries. Popular for students who enjoy social life and city vibes. The commute to Brisbane CBD or nearby universities is 5–10 minutes by bus or train. Average weekly rent is $450–$650/week.
3. Fortitude Valley – Known as “The Valley,” this area is buzzing with nightlife, live music, and boutique shops. Ideal for students who want an active social scene. The commute to the Central Business District or universities is 5–15 minutes by bus or train. Rent typically ranges from $400–$600/week.
4. Toowong – Close to UQ and city transport links, Toowong is convenient for students who want a quieter, more residential area with shopping and cafés nearby. Commute to CBD is 10–15 minutes by bus or bike. Average rent is around $400–$550/week.
5. Woolloongabba – A trendy area with markets, cafés, and easy access to public transport. Popular with students and young professionals. The commute to Brisbane CBD or universities is about 10–15 minutes by bus or train. Rent usually falls between $400–$600/week.
